Surface cleaning is the removal of all manner of mold and stains from your flat surfaces. This includes driveways, retaining walls, walkways, and steps.

Approach and Technique

The approach to concrete is straightforward. Apply the solution and wash it off with medium to high pressure. When assessing your driveway, whether it be concrete or asphalt, we note any distress cracks, non-organic staining, and areas that may raise a flag. We like to keep our customers informed in a holistic way about the status of their surface. This makes for a fuller, more responsible, and well-rounded experience.

To wash concrete we apply a semi-strong solution to the surface. We then use a large round surface cleaner, much like a lawn mower, to slowly go back and forth over the treated surface. This removes all dirt and organic growth in a safe, effective way. For asphalt the treatment is different. Asphalt is more delicate so we like to apply a weak, potentially different solution, followed by a low pressure rinse. Asphalt can easily come apart and it should be approached with caution.
